The isolated box Diaries

They can be made use of is several enterprise purposes and in lots of desktop software (to store user info in Harmless locations, one example is). A single principal use is in locations the place .

Make and persist variations to your dev container, for instance installation of recent software, by means of usage of a Dockerfile.

You'll be prompted to pick a pre-outlined container configuration from our initial-occasion and community index within a filterable listing sorted based upon your folder's contents. With the VS Code UI, you could possibly pick out certainly one of the subsequent Templates as a starting point for Docker Compose:

Within the specialized degree, Just about every container is simply a Linux process that is certainly isolated from the rest of the process with the assistance in the now described and a few further applications.

A vital position here would be that the ip command we’re working is staying sourced through the host VM and doesn’t should exist Within the container. This can make it a useful approach for troubleshooting networking challenges in locked down containers that don’t have plenty of utilities put in in them.

If devcontainer.json's supported workflows do not meet your requirements, It's also possible to connect to an presently jogging container alternatively.

Load extra… Strengthen this site Include an outline, impression, and backlinks for the remote-containers subject web site in order that builders can extra simply study it. read more Curate this subject

You furthermore mght will not be mapping the neighborhood filesystem into the container or exposing ports to other assets like databases you ought to obtain.

Which means that you are able to seamlessly change your total enhancement environment just by connecting to a special container.

As we’ll see, containers use these factors to produce a division involving their dispensable volumes and also the hosts.

Permit’s produce a new directory to serve as our new root and mount a temporary file procedure on it, which makes an vacant, memory-based mostly file system for our new root. Change to The brand new root directory and execute pivot_root.

For this instance, if you would like to setup the Code Spell Checker extension into your container and mechanically ahead port 3000, your devcontainer.json would appear like:

To substantiate that our tmpfs is accurately mounted, we are able to utilize the df command. The output with none filesystem demonstrates that we have a 24GB tmpfs mounted at /tmp/new_root.

Isolated storage could be treated as a small for each application filesystem in which an application can preserve files.

Leave a Reply

Your email address will not be published. Required fields are marked *